OpenOffice.org becomes LibreOffice

The OpenOffice.org Project has unveiled that it is separating itself from Oracle. OpenOffice’s development and direction will be decided by a steering committee of developers and national language project managers. Sony Zaps PlayStation 3 ‘Install Other OS’ Feature

when sony release the new update on 1 april for the PS3,  the “Install Other OS” option will not be available anymore sony have decided to remove that from the PS3. opting out will bar access to the playstation network, newer games and blu-ray movies, copyright-protected videos streamed from a media server, and any other [...]
